Montessori Animal 3-part Cards

These educational tools are designed to enhance language development, vocabulary expansion, and classification skills in children. Each set typically consists of three cards: a control card featuring the image and name of an animal, a picture card displaying only the animal’s image, and a label card bearing the animal’s name. The activity begins with the child matching the picture card to the control card, building visual recognition and associating the image with its corresponding word. Subsequently, the label card is introduced, requiring the child to match the word to both the picture and the control card. This multi-sensory approach reinforces learning by engaging visual, tactile, and auditory pathways. For example, a set might include cards featuring a lion, an elephant, and a giraffe. The child first matches the picture card of the lion to the control card, then adds the label card “Lion” to complete the set. This process allows for repetition and gradual mastery, fostering a sense of accomplishment.

The significance of this learning method lies in its ability to foster independence, concentration, and order core tenets of the Montessori philosophy. By working with these materials, children develop the ability to self-correct, identifying and rectifying errors independently. This promotes a sense of autonomy and responsibility, encouraging them to take ownership of their learning process. Historically, Dr. Maria Montessori recognized the importance of providing children with concrete, hands-on learning experiences to facilitate deeper understanding. This approach aligns with the natural developmental stages of children, particularly their inclination towards exploring and manipulating objects. Furthermore, the use of real-life images instead of cartoonish representations helps children connect with the natural world, building a foundation for scientific understanding and appreciation for biodiversity. The simplicity of the activity belies its profound impact on a child’s cognitive development, making it a valuable tool for educators and parents alike.

The effectiveness of these materials extends beyond basic vocabulary building. They also serve as a springboard for exploring diverse topics related to zoology, geography, and ecology. Once a child has mastered the identification of various creatures, the learning can be extended to include discussions about their habitats, diets, and behaviors. For instance, after working with the card set, a teacher might introduce additional resources such as books, videos, or even field trips to zoos or nature reserves to enrich the learning experience. Moreover, these sets can be customized to suit different age groups and learning objectives. Younger children may benefit from simpler sets featuring common domestic animals, while older children may be challenged with more complex classifications, such as endangered species or animals from specific regions. The adaptability and versatility of these teaching aids make them an indispensable part of a well-rounded educational program.
